Council reviews FY2027 budget requests including animal-shelter trailer, fire safety equipment and drone program

City of Rosenberg City Council (workshop) · May 26, 2026

Summary

Council examined a range of FY2027 supplemental and capital requests spanning animal‑shelter outreach, fire‑service compliance equipment and a proposed drone-as‑first‑responder program, and asked staff for cost details and grant options.

During the workshop, staff walked council through supplemental and capital requests across funds and answered council questions about specific high-cost items and funding sources.

Omar (speaker 9) described a mobile adoption trailer under consideration as a bumper-pull unit capable of transporting 11–12 animals, with on-board handwashing and holding tanks; he said grant funds could be used to supplement the purchase. On fire and safety requests, staff explained the need for specialized equipment such as a bunker-gear dryer and a breathing-air compressor to meet inspection and NFPA compliance. A public‑safety presentation described a $160,000 drone-as‑first‑responder program that would be docked and dispatchable, giving immediate scene visuals through a laptop interface.

Council members asked staff for detailed descriptions and price breakdowns for high-cost items (for example the $70,000 adoption trailer and an $80,000 vehicle request for an administrative captain) and whether items could be funded through grants or special funds; staff said some items are funded from dedicated special‑revenue accounts (hotel/motel funds, CCPD funds, fleet replacement) and others would require budget prioritization.

Next steps: staff will provide more detailed cost descriptions, funding-source suggestions (grant feasibility), and prioritization for inclusion in the FY2027 budget documents.
